Landlord Tenant ActThe landlord is the legal owner of a place that is being rented by the landlord to a tenant in exchange of rent. There is an agreement between the landlord and the tenant before the tenant moves in the house. This agreement is called the lease. Each and every thing that can be a matter of dispute in the future is mentioned in the lease.

This include the security deposit, monthly rent and the date when rent will be paid off , the term of the tenancy, etc. this all should be written very clearly. In case of any dispute in the future between the tenant and the landlord, the lease is very important in making the decision. Tenancy AgreementThe term, tenancy agreement stands as an effective set of rights and responsibilities of the tenant and landlord. The terms are usually considered under the series of the law. Landlord should understand that the law act allow the tenant to make use of the property the way they like to. It is therefore important to listed prohibited activities that are must mention into the tenancy agreement.

However, European Union Directive restricted the scope to act on unfair terms in Consumer Contract Regulation.  Therefore, if there is any specific term that is not covered under the standard tenancy agreement you need to seek legal advice or can refer to the “Guidance on Unfair Terms in Tenancy Agreements”.

The tenancy agreement is prepared on the basis of description of the property, payment of rent, interest on arrears, council tax, water charges utility, repair and decoration, alterations, use, insurance, assignment, subletting, addresses for service and rent increases.
